68 reviews
205 reviews
15 reviews
2.8k reviews
(Save £22.50)
Regular price was £112
1 review
233 reviews
(Save £53)
Regular price was £106
9 reviews
489 reviews
(Save £9.01)
Regular price was £50
8 reviews
(Save £22)
Regular price was £110
2 reviews
(Save £23.25)
Regular price was £75
239 reviews
6 reviews
(Save £6.25)
Regular price was £62
11 reviews
524 reviews
4 reviews
190 reviews
14 reviews
753 reviews
3 reviews
17.6k reviews
908 reviews
17 reviews
182 reviews
(Save £38.75)
10 reviews
18k reviews